Top foam sealant manufacturer and supplier: Applications in the Automotive Industry The automotive industry relies on PU foam sealant for sealing, insulating, and vibration-dampening applications that enhance vehicle comfort and performance. It is widely used to fill cavities in car bodies, doors, pillars, and trunks, where it helps reduce noise, vibration, and harshness during driving. PU foam sealant also contributes to thermal insulation, supporting better climate control inside the vehicle cabin. Its lightweight properties are particularly valuable as automakers seek to reduce overall vehicle weight to improve fuel efficiency and meet emission regulations. Additionally, PU foam sealant offers strong adhesion to metal and composite materials, ensuring reliable performance under constant vibration and temperature changes. In electric vehicles, it is increasingly used to seal battery compartments and protect sensitive components from moisture and dust. The material’s ability to cure quickly and expand precisely allows for efficient automated application on production lines. With ongoing innovation in vehicle design and materials, PU foam sealant remains a key component in achieving quieter, safer, and more energy-efficient automobiles. Energy efficiency and noise reduction are priorities in modern buildings. PU sealant excels in both thermal and acoustic insulation. How It’s Used? High-performance polyurethane sealant forms a filling around windows, doors, and walls, keeping the heat in. The foam-like nature makes it close even minute crevices, thereby increasing energy efficiency. During cold weather, it is used to make homes warm, thus saving on heating expenses. To soundproof, it deadens both traffic noise and noise between rooms, making it suitable for urban apartments or offices. PU sealant is used in commercial buildings to insulate HVAC ducts, preventing air leakage and enhancing the system’s performance. Its versatility makes it frequently used in green construction projects. Polyurethane sealant is a high-performance bonding agent in windows, panels, and modular constructions. It glues glass and aluminum frames to plywood and drywall without cracking.
Application in Electrical and Plumbing Installations Electrical and plumbing systems require effective sealing around penetrations to maintain safety, efficiency, and building integrity. PU foam sealant is commonly used to seal gaps around pipes, conduits, cables, and junction boxes as they pass through walls, floors, and ceilings. By filling these openings, the foam prevents air leakage, moisture intrusion, and pest entry. In plumbing applications, PU foam sealant helps stabilize pipes and reduces vibration and noise caused by water flow. For electrical installations, it provides an added layer of insulation and protection without conducting electricity. The foam’s ability to expand into irregular spaces ensures complete coverage even in hard-to-reach areas. Once cured, it maintains its shape and adhesion over time, reducing the need for frequent maintenance. Its ease of application allows installers to work quickly and efficiently on-site. As building systems become more complex and integrated, PU foam sealant remains an essential material for ensuring clean, secure, and long-lasting electrical and plumbing installations.
PU sealants offer many advantages. But you must learn how to apply and manage them properly: Curing Conditions: Low moisture or cold weather can delay the setting process. Surface Setup: Dirty bases make bonding tougher. Cleaning and priming might be needed. Know what’s best: Not every PU type can resist sunlight. For exterior projects, UV-resistant options are best. Safety: PU sealants may have solvents or isocyanates in them; therefore, you need to make sure there is enough air flow and wear the right safety gear. Why Choose Shuode PU Sealant? Use of PU Foam Sealant in Appliance Manufacturing Household and commercial appliance manufacturers rely on PU foam sealant for insulation, sealing, and assembly efficiency. It is commonly used in refrigerators, freezers, water heaters, ovens, and air-conditioning units to seal joints and improve thermal performance. By reducing heat transfer and air leakage, PU foam sealant helps appliances operate more efficiently and consume less energy. The foam’s ability to bond to metal and plastic components ensures reliable sealing throughout the product’s lifespan. In addition to insulation, PU foam sealant also provides vibration reduction, contributing to quieter appliance operation. Its fast curing time supports high-speed production lines and automated application systems. The lightweight nature of the foam allows manufacturers to enhance performance without increasing product weight. As appliance efficiency standards become more stringent worldwide, PU foam sealant continues to play a crucial role in meeting regulatory requirements and consumer expectations for durability, efficiency, and comfort.
